Sažetak
In order for business organizations to meet the increasing expectations of users, a quality transport organization is one of the most important factors in the overall process chain and cost optimization. The service user wants a quality, favorable and fast service and therefore it is extremely important to rationalize the transportation. One of the ways to make the service faster, cheaper and better in implementing the technological process is by using mathematical models and software routing tools. The purpose of this paper is to analyse the different ways of determining the route and how they affect the overall delivery process of delivery to the ultimate recipient in the urban area. Concrete comparisons, along with certain route parameters, will also show the delivery results
